GLOBE Observer Connect 19 March 2026: Bringing Your Observations to Meteorologists
In March 2025, environmental data collected by the GLOBE community became available in NOAA’s Meteorological Assimilation Data Ingest System (MADIS). Supported by Synoptic Data, this integration helps bridge the gap between citizen science and professional meteorological analysis. By making GLOBE observations available via MADIS and the Synoptic Data Viewer, the GLOBE community is contributing data to help scientists understand Earth’s complex systems.
In this GLOBE Observer Connect session held on 19 March 2026, we heard directly from the architects of this collaboration, including a conversation with staff from the GLOBE Program Office, NOAA, and Synoptic Data, who shared insights into this exciting milestone, described examples of how the data are used, and demonstrated how the data in MADIS can be accessed.
